The Black Tie Comedy Awards  Winners are:


BEST NEWCOMER: KEVIN J


BEST TV PERFORMANCE: SLIM


BEST FEMALE COMEDIAN: GLENDA JAXSON


BEST MALE COMEDIAN: SLIM


BEST COMEDY PROMOTION: HARMONY PRODUCTIONS


BEST INTERNATIONAL: CHRIS ROCK


OUTSTANDING ACHIEVEMENT: THE CAST OF REAL MCCOY
